About Unity
Unity is a company based in San Francisco (United States) founded in 2004 by David Helgason. It operates as a SaaS (Software-as-a-Service), Subscription Services, and Advertising Model. Unity has raised $893.5 million across 10 funding rounds from investors including CPP Investments, PRIMECAP and Light Street Capital. The company has 4,990 employees as of December 31, 2024. Unity has completed 25 acquisitions, including Artomatix, Chilli Connect and Codice Software. Unity offers products and services including Unity Engine, Unity Ads, and Unity Asset Store. Unity operates in a competitive market with competitors including Animoca Brands, Epic Games, Autodesk, Rec Room and Playco, among others.

Unity is utilized as a premier real-time development platform for creating 2D, 3D, VR, and AR experiences. It is widely adopted in the gaming industry, supporting over 20 end-user platforms. Tools and services are provided for game creation, launch, and growth, alongside solutions for industries transforming CAD and 3D data into immersive applications. A dynamic community and extensive resources are maintained to assist creators globally.
